Transaction 32e58ec814aa5909d5638606e1f8f9b1c41e2fdc6652cfe3643d0367b6d42341
1 Input
1 Output
-
32e58ec814aa5909d5638606e1f8f9b1c41e2fdc6652cfe3643d0367b6d42341:0
- value
- 1076713
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ff4fb4de935805069c158b9a712d555102d56c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E8B74EU7v7x9geLZULLytmPg34eh8Zitw